On 06/18/2015 12:54 PM, Viresh Kumar wrote:
Migrate asm9260 driver to the new 'set-state' interface provided by
clockevents core, the earlier 'set-mode' interface is marked obsolete
now.
This also enables us to implement callbacks for new states of clockevent
devices, for example: ONESHOT_STOPPED.
Could you add in the changelog the subtle change with set_mode(RESUME)
and this code. As a default the timer was stopped when entering in the
set_mode function, now with the new API, this is done explicitly.
